High-purity electronic-grade silane is a specialty gas of exceptional purity with the chemical formula SiH4. It is colorless, odorless, and flammable. Its core value lies in its extremely low impurity content (typically exceeding 99.9999%), meeting the stringent material purity requirements of high-tech industries such as semiconductor manufacturing, photovoltaic cells, and display panels. As a key raw material, it is directly involved in core processes such as crystalline silicon film deposition and silicon nitride film preparation, providing a fundamental guarantee for improving the performance and reliability of electronic devices. In 2024, the production of high-purity electronic-grade silane reached 8,600 tons, with an average selling price of US,000 per ton. The industry's gross profit margin is approximately 25-35%.
The unit price of high-purity electronic-grade silane is influenced by purity level, application area, and market supply and demand. The semiconductor industry has the highest purity requirements, resulting in a significantly higher unit price than the photovoltaic or display panel sectors. Leading companies maintain high gross profit margins through large-scale production, process optimization (such as the chlorosilane method and plasma catalysis technology), and vertical integration of the supply chain. However, fluctuations in raw material prices (such as silicon powder and hydrogen), increased environmental protection spending, and pressure for technological iteration may compress short-term profit margins. Companies need to stabilize profitability through customized product development (such as melt-zone-grade polysilicon) and increased customer loyalty.
Market drivers include the following:
Demand: The semiconductor industry's transition to advanced processes (such as those below 5nm) and intensified competition in photovoltaic cell efficiency are driving continued growth in demand for high-purity silane. The commercialization of emerging sectors such as silicon-based anode materials for power batteries and third-generation semiconductors (such as silicon carbide) is further expanding the market.
Supply: Technical barriers (such as purity control and safe production) and customer certification cycles (over two years in the semiconductor industry) restrict new entrants, while existing companies consolidate their advantages through capacity expansion and technological upgrades.
Policy: Global support for renewable energy and high-end manufacturing is accelerating the localization of the supply chain. Domestic companies, leveraging their cost advantages and rapid response capabilities, are gradually replacing imported products.

Silanes are monomeric silicon compounds with four substituents, or groups, attached to the silicon atom. These groups can be the same or different and nonreactive or reactive, with the reactivity being inorganic or organic. Inorganic reactive silanes have alkoxysilane groups and undergo hydrolytic polycondensation reactions.
